In summary, the discovery of the Higgs Boson particle in 2012 by scientists at the Large Hadron Collider has helped unravel the mystery of how particles gain mass in the quantum world. The Higgs Boson, also known as the "God particle," is responsible for giving particles their mass through interaction with the Higgs field. This breakthrough has confirmed the Standard Model of particle physics and has opened up new possibilities for understanding the fundamental building blocks of the universe. Further research and experiments on the Higgs Boson may lead to a deeper understanding of the nature of mass and the fundamental laws of the universe.
